A parity code interpretation of nucleotide alphabet composition.

Dónall A Mac Dónaill1.   

Abstract

The purine-pyrimidine and hydrogen donor-acceptor patterns governing nucleotide recognition are shown to correspond formally to a digital error-detection (parity) code, suggesting that factors other than physiochemical issues alone shaped the natural nucleotide alphabet.
